Australia's homeless rate is on the rise according to new figures from the Bureau of Statistics.
The 2006 Census figures reveal there is an extra 6000 homeless people living in Australia since the previous census in 2001.
Mission Australia boss Toby Hall says while it comes as no surprise, it is two years on and the current numbers could be even higher.
"We see more people coming to our services. We've had to often turn away people in the past," Mr Hall said.
"Now these numbers relate to 2006 and since that point there's been a significant growth in housing cost, so we think it will be an even bigger growth if the same stats were taken today."
